Position Summary: Under the leadership of the departmental Nursing Director, the Registered Nurse (RN) I is an active member of the department that utilizes the nursing process in assessing, planning, implementing, and evaluating patient care. The RN I must be able to collaborate with other professional disciplines as well as interact with the patient, family members, and significant others. The RN I will provide care for patients from various types of illness or trauma requiring basic, advanced, or emergency attention. The Nurse must be able to recognize and effectively implement treatments for life threatening conditions. The RN I is also responsible for providing care that is appropriate for the patient’s developmental age and is culturally sensitive. The Registered Nurse I duties are of considerable difficulty and are based on scientific principles and standards of nursing practice. Basic Qualifications: Education: Requires an Associate’s degree in Nursing from an accredited school of nursing. Experience: Requires up to one year of work-related experience, or any equivalent combination of education, training, and experience. Licensure, Registrations & Certifications: Requires a current state license as a Registered Nurse and is listed in good standing with the state’s Department of Professional Credentialing. Requires a current certification in Basic Life Support. ACLS and PALS must be obtained within six months of ED employment. TNCC is recommended.
